我正在嘗試通過 matlab 腳本運行 git 命令并獲取終端輸出。我在跑步時取得了成功
[status,cmdoutput] = system('TERM=ansi git diff-tree -r --name-only asdasd asdasdas');
但是,如果我使用 git diff 而不是 git diff-tree,我會得到空結果。我試圖在運行良好的終端上運行相同的命令。
作業系統:Ubuntu 18.04 MATLAB R2020b
任何幫助表示贊賞:)
uj5u.com熱心網友回復:
它可能與尋呼機有關。我一直在 Ubuntu 20.04 上使用以下代碼沒有問題
[~, cmdoutput] = system('git --no-pager diff --no-color');
轉載請註明出處,本文鏈接:https://www.uj5u.com/shujuku/530081.html
標籤:混帐matlab
